
On a visit to China 2 years ago, I visited a factory in the Guangdong Province that made Computer Tables. It was a Factory Spread over 1 Acre of land and employed over 350 + Employees. It was a typical Family run Chinese Small & Medium Enterprise Factory setup in the last decade amidst China’s great economic boom. After our Business Talk we walked around the factory and saw a Huge Production Line with its sweating workers and gurgling machines, a Planned Loading and Unloading Area, a Small Conference Room to Interact with Customers/Business Associates and a Mess Type Eating Area for the Staff. But there was something which appeared to be missing. The Missing thing was a dedicated department for keeping accounts, filing files, maintaining statutory records. Such a thing was non-existent. When we enquired with the Owner about where is the department to maintain accounting records and paper work , he just pointed to 1 Man sitting on a Table with a Cupboard behind him. In India if a Factory were to Employ 350 People and be a Manufacturing Unit dedicated to Export, a Factory would need at least 5 full time employees in a Dedicated Department for Accounting, Documentation, Paperwork etc. Employing 350 People would require maintaining a multitude of Records, Paper work and Files related to Accounts, ESI, PF, Banking, Export Incentives, Labour, Corporation, Power etc which would need at least a Small Store Room. But the Chinese can do this with 1 Man and 1 Cupboard. It’s a Strange Reality but True !!!
